Patra Chawl Land Scam: In the Patra Chawl land scam case, the Enforcement Directorate (ED) raided the house of Shiv Sena leader Sanjay Raut for hours after which he was taken into custody. However, he says that I take the oath of late Balasaheb Thackeray that I have no connection with any scam.
Hours after the Enforcement Directorate (ED) raided the residence of Shiv Sena leader Sanjay Raut in the Patra Chawl land scam case, he was detained. A large number of policemen were deployed outside his house as his supporters started gathering there. The ED took them with him after taking him into custody. He greeted the party workers present on the spot by raising his hands.
ED officials along with Central Industrial Security Force personnel reached Sanjay Raut’s Bhandup suburb residence ‘Maitri’ at 7 am today and started raids. Meanwhile, Raut, a Rajya Sabha member, has denied any wrongdoing and alleged that he is being targeted to seek political vendetta. Shortly after the ED action, he tweeted that I swear by late Balasaheb Thackeray that I have no connection with any scam. He wrote that I will die, but will not leave Shiv Sena.

What is the whole matter?
Sanjay Raut’s wife Varsha and Swapna owned a land in Alibaug which was bought in their joint names. The ED suspects that arrested businessman Praveen Raut, through Swapna Patkar’s estranged husband Sujit Patkar, had bought the land with money diverted from Patra Chawl fraud. Praveen Raut is a friend of Sanjay Raut.

What is the charge of ED?
In April, the ED attached a flat in Mumbai and Alibaug land owned by Sanjay Raut’s wife Varsha. The ED had alleged that these properties were purchased with money diverted by Praveen Raut. On the other hand, during the recent searches at the premises of Swapna Patkar, the ED found documents of Alibaug land. Earlier in her statement to the ED, Swapna told that her name was used to buy the land though she had no ownership rights on it and the ownership of the land parcel is under complete control of Sanjay Raut. This whole scam is more than 1 thousand crores.
